How they compare

Northern Mariana Islands currently reports 49.7% against 2.6% in Latin America & the Caribbean (IDA & IBRD countries), a difference of 47.1%.

That makes Northern Mariana Islands's figure about 19.3 times Latin America & the Caribbean (IDA & IBRD countries)'s.

Across all 8 years both countries report, Northern Mariana Islands has been ahead every year.

Latin America & the Caribbean (IDA & IBRD countries) ranks 20th and Northern Mariana Islands ranks 19th of 47 groups.

Northern Mariana Islands has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Latin America & the Caribbean (IDA & IBRD countries) Northern Mariana Islands Difference Ahead
1990s 1.4% 64.3% 62.9% Northern Mariana Islands
2000s 1.1% 59.5% 58.3% Northern Mariana Islands
2010s 1.3% 43.4% 42.0% Northern Mariana Islands
2020s 2.3% 47.9% 45.5% Northern Mariana Islands

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

International migrant stock (% of population) is the proportion of people at mid-year born in a country other than that in which they live. It also includes refugees.
